Obituaries - Dec. 22, 1987
John F. O’Leary, U.S. Nuclear Energy Expert
John F. O’Leary, 61, who served in the Interior, Energy and Atomic Energy departments and the Bureau of Mines under Presidents John F. Kennedy, Lyndon B. Johnson, Richard M. Nixon and Jimmy Carter. Most recently he was chairman of the General Public Utilities Corp., the company that runs the Three Mile Island nuclear power plant in Harrisburg, Pa. O’Leary was credited with playing a key role in guiding the company after the Three Mile Island accident and was seen on such television programs as “Good Morning America” and the “McNeil-Lehrer Report” as a commentator and expert on world energy matters. In Parsippany, N.J., on Saturday of cancer.
